The Urban Renewal Authority operates as a statutory body dedicated to the comprehensive revitalization of the built environment in Hong Kong. It fulfills its mission by managing large-scale redevelopment projects and facilitating the rehabilitation of aging buildings. Through a holistic approach, the organization balances physical reconstruction with the preservation of cultural heritage and local revitalization efforts. These activities are designed to enhance the quality of life for residents while ensuring the long-term sustainability of the city’s infrastructure. The authority remains guided by government strategies to create a modern and resilient urban landscape.
